PHILADELPHIA (WPVI) -- One person is dead and another critically injured after more than 20 shots were fired in South Philadelphia Thursday evening, according to police.
The shooting happened just after 6 p.m. near Broad Street and Packer Avenue.
Police say a man in his 20s was found shot multiple times throughout his body. He was rushed to a nearby hospital, where he was pronounced dead.
A second victim, also a man in his 20s, ran to a nearby bar for help after being shot twice in the torso. He was taken to the hospital in critical condition.
Chief Inspector Scott Small said a vehicle believed to be connected to the victims was found still running and unattended near the scene.
